One-day diving excursions in Punta Cana
The most common are Isla Saona and Isla Catalina. The wonderful thing about these excursions with our water sports centre is that they are perfectly compatible with people who do not dive and prefer to do a little snorkelling and enjoy the excursion itself.
- The tour begins first thing in the morning, when a bus comes to pick you up at the hotel door to take you to the boarding point.
- During the trip the guides will give you the guidelines of the excursion, and they will also explain how the divers and non-divers will be organized.
- The excursions to these islands are carried out with the same normality as the ones that do not include diving, except for the detail that they will make technical stops so that those who dive can do their immersion while those who do not dive can stay on the boat enjoying or snorkelling.
- Excursions of this type always end on a wonderful Caribbean beach, with a tropical and Dominican lunch. This is followed by a well-deserved siesta in the sun or under the coconut trees (as desired by the client) and then back to the hotel. Photo sessions are also optional on this type of excursion. Half-day diving excursions in Punta Cana
There are more than 15 different dive sites in this area, including sites such as wrecks, reef, wall… half-day excursions of one or two tanks can be made depending on the client’s request.

And since these are points close to the hotel, if you leave in the morning, you will be back at noon to eat at our facilities. Obviously depending on the experience of the diver, our experts will recommend which ones have the right depths.

More than 100 kilometers of crystal clear and turquoise waters await you along the coast of the Riviera Maya. It is part of the Mesoamerican Reef System, one of the largest barrier reef systems in the world. Home to incredible sea creatures, coral reefs and many other underwater surprises that you will love to discover.
Diving options are not limited to the great open ocean waters. In the Riviera Maya you will also have the opportunity to explore the ancient sacred waters of the Mexican cenotes.
These limestone sinkholes compensate for the exotic and extraordinary microcosms of water of all that is beautiful and special about Mexico. Swim through caves, underwater rivers and amazing natural structures that have existed for thousands of years.
